
부대, 마대, 봉지
A large bag made of a strong material such as burlap, thick paper, or plastic, used for storing and carrying goods.
예문:
"We bought a fifty-pound sack of dog food that should last us a month."
"The farmer hauled the heavy sacks of grain onto the truck bed."
"Could you put the apples in a paper sack, please?"
해고, 파면
Dismissal from employment, often used in the phrases 'get the sack' or 'give someone the sack'.
예문:
"After the budget cuts, several employees were worried they might get the sack."
"His repeated tardiness finally resulted in him being given the sack."
해고하다, 파면하다
To dismiss someone from employment; to fire.
예문:
"The manager had to sack three workers who were caught stealing inventory."
"If you keep missing deadlines, they are certainly going to sack you."
약탈하다, 파괴하다
(Chiefly historical) To plunder and destroy a captured town, building, or other place.
예문:
"The invading army sacked the ancient city, leaving nothing but ruins behind."
"Historians recorded that the fortress was sacked multiple times during the medieval period."
침상, 잠자리
Bed or sleeping place.
예문:
"I'm exhausted; I'm going to hit the sack early tonight."
"He stayed in the sack until noon because it was his day off."
색(쿼터백 태클)
(American Football) An act of tackling a quarterback behind the line of scrimmage before he can throw a pass.
예문:
"The defensive end recorded his third sack of the game in the final quarter."
"The coach praised the linebacker for executing a perfect blindside sack."
